What is Ayurvedic Third-Party Manufacturing?

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ing is a process where a company outsources the production of its Ayurvedic products to a third-party manufacturer. This method allows businesses to leverage the expertise and facilities of specialized manufacturers to produce high-quality Ayurvedic products under their brand name. It is a widely adopted practice in the pharmaceutical and wellness industries, particularly in the Ayurvedic sector, where demand for natural and traditional remedies continues to grow.

The Process of Ayurvedic Third-Party Manufacturing

The process of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ing involves several key steps:

Product Conceptualization and Formulation: The client company develops the concept and formulation for the Ayurvedic product they wish to produce. This stage includes selecting the ingredients, determining dosages, and finalizing the product’s specifications.

Selection of a Third-Party Manufacturer: The client then selects an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ing company that meets their requirements. Factors like manufacturing capacity, quality standards, and certifications are crucial considerations during this selection process.

Contract Agreement: A contract is established between the client and the third-party manufacturer. This agreement outlines the terms, including the scope of work, production timelines, pricing, and confidentiality clauses.

Manufacturing: Once the contract is signed, the third-party manufacturer begins the production process. This includes sourcing raw materials, blending, processing, and packaging the Ayurvedic products according to the client’s specifications.

Quality Control and Testing: The products undergo rigorous quality control checks to ensure they meet industry standards and are free from contaminants.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ing companies typically have in-house laboratories for testing and validation.

Packaging and Labeling: After passing quality checks, the products are packaged and labeled under the client’s brand name. The packaging is designed to meet the client’s branding requirements and regulatory standards.

Delivery: The finished products are then delivered to the client, ready for distribution and sale.

Benefits of Ayurvedic Third-Party Manufacturing

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ing offers numerous benefits to businesses looking to enter or expand within the Ayurvedic market. Some of the key advantages include:

Cost-Effective Production: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ing helps companies reduce production costs by eliminating the need for expensive manufacturing facilities and equipment. This cost-effectiveness is especially beneficial for startups and small businesses with limited capital.

Focus on Core Competencies: By outsourcing manufacturing, companies can focus on their core competencies, such as research and development, branding, and marketing. This allows them to build stronger brand identities and market their products more effectively.

Access to Expertise and Technology: Ayurvedic third-party manufacturers have the expertise and advanced technology necessary to produce high-quality products. They are well-versed in traditional Ayurvedic practices and modern manufacturing techniques, ensuring that the products are both authentic and effective.

Scalability: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ing allows companies to scale their production according to demand without the need for additional investments in manufacturing infrastructure. This flexibility is essential for businesses looking to grow rapidly in the competitive Ayurvedic market.

Compliance with Regulations: Ayurvedic third-party manufacturers are usually well-versed in industry regulations and standards. They ensure that the products are manufactured in compliance with all relevant guidelines, which helps avoid legal and regulatory issues.

Challenges in Ayurvedic Third-Party Manufacturing

While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ing offers many benefits, it also comes with its own set of challenges. Some of these challenges include:

Quality Control: Ensuring consistent quality across batches can be challenging, especially when working with multiple third-party manufacturers. It’s crucial for companies to choose manufacturers with strict quality control measures.

Dependence on the Manufacturer: Companies that rely heavily on Ayurvedic third-party manufacturers may face challenges if the manufacturer experiences delays, quality issues, or other operational problems.

Intellectual Property Risks: Sharing product formulations with a third-party manufacturer can pose risks to intellectual property. Companies must ensure that their agreements include strong confidentiality clauses to protect their proprietary information.

Regulatory Compliance: Although third-party manufacturers are typically responsible for regulatory compliance, the client company must still ensure that the final products meet all legal requirements. Failure to comply with regulations can lead to fines, recalls, or damage to the company’s reputation.

Choosing the Right Ayurvedic Third-Party Manufacturer

Selecting the right Ayurvedic third-party manufacturer is crucial for the success of any Ayurvedic product line. Companies should consider several factors when choosing a manufacturing partner:

Experience and Expertise: It’s important to choose a manufacturer with extensive experience in Ayurvedic third-party manufacturing. They should have a deep understanding of Ayurvedic principles and the ability to produce high-quality products.

Certifications and Standards: The manufacturer should hold relevant certifications, such as G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ices), ISO, and AYUSH certifications. These certifications ensure that the manufacturer adheres to strict quality standards.

Manufacturing Capacity: The manufacturer should have the capacity to meet your production needs, both in terms of volume and timelines. It’s essential to assess their facilities and equipment to ensure they can handle your production requirements.

Reputation and Reviews: Research the manufacturer’s reputation in the industry. Look for reviews and testimonials from other companies that have worked with them. A manufacturer with a strong track record is more likely to deliver high-quality products.

Transparency and Communication: A good Ayurvedic third-party manufacturer should be transparent about their processes and open to communication. Clear communication is essential for ensuring that the final products meet your expectations.
